Output 4bab276d29d28b44980b4018a684710e517060bbed1f90f8fb397590eaa424a1:0

value
69650
script pubkey
OP_HASH160 OP_PUSHBYTES_20 254f94877ab7476801068631761580ee34351326 OP_EQUAL
address
356JFyDuyB237CMDaZN2Awr4Nqp5h5tLQC
transaction
4bab276d29d28b44980b4018a684710e517060bbed1f90f8fb397590eaa424a1
spent
true